Why installation efficiency matters in interior projects
In real projects, wall finishes are often installed under tight schedules. Delays caused by complex installation steps, drying times, or post-finishing work can quickly increase labor costs and disrupt handover timelines.
Traditional wall finishes may require:
-
Surface leveling and priming
-
Painting or coating after installation
-
Drying and curing time
-
Frequent touch-ups
WPC wall panels are designed to reduce these steps, making them attractive for both new builds and renovations.
Prefabricated panels for predictable installation
One of the key advantages of WPC wall panels is that they are factory-finished products. This means:
-
Color and texture are consistent across panels
-
No on-site painting or surface treatment is required
-
Quality is controlled before delivery
For contractors, this predictability reduces rework and simplifies quality checks during installation.
Faster renovation with minimal disruption
In renovation projects—especially hotels, apartments, offices, or occupied buildings—speed matters as much as appearance. WPC wall panels support:
-
Dry installation methods
-
Reduced dust and odor compared with paint or plaster
-
Faster room turnover
This makes them suitable for projects where spaces must return to use quickly, such as hospitality or rental properties.
Compatibility with common fixing systems
Interior WPC wall panels are typically designed to work with standard mounting structures, such as battens or concealed fastening systems. This allows:
-
Straightforward alignment and leveling
-
Easy replacement of individual panels if needed
-
Adaptation to uneven or existing wall surfaces
For installers, this flexibility reduces the need for extensive wall preparation.
Reduced labor dependency
Highly skilled finishing labor is increasingly difficult to source in many markets. WPC wall panels help mitigate this challenge because:
-
Installation is more mechanical than artisanal
-
Results are less dependent on individual craftsmanship
-
Training requirements for installers are lower
This makes project costs more predictable and scalable across multiple sites.
Long-term maintenance and ownership cost
Beyond installation, wall finishes continue to generate costs over their lifetime. Common issues with traditional walls include:
-
Peeling paint
-
Cracks due to movement or humidity
-
Stains that are difficult to remove
WPC wall panels are valued for their low-maintenance surfaces, which typically require only routine cleaning rather than periodic refurbishment.
Over time, this can significantly reduce:
-
Maintenance labor
-
Material replacement frequency
-
Operational disruption
Durability in high-traffic interiors
In commercial interiors such as corridors, offices, retail spaces, or public areas, walls are frequently exposed to contact and wear.
WPC wall panels offer:
-
Better resistance to minor impacts
-
More stable surfaces under daily use
-
Longer visual consistency compared with painted walls
This durability supports a longer service life, especially in high-traffic zones.
Planning consistency across multi-room projects
For projects involving multiple rooms or buildings, consistency is critical. WPC wall panels provide:
-
Uniform appearance across large areas
-
Batch production consistency
-
Easier color and texture matching for future expansions
This is particularly valuable for developers managing phased projects or standardized interior concepts.
Environmental and material efficiency in construction
From a project planning standpoint, WPC panels also contribute to material efficiency by:
-
Reducing waste from on-site finishing
-
Lowering repainting cycles over time
-
Extending replacement intervals
For projects with sustainability targets, this efficiency supports long-term environmental goals without compromising practicality.
